Making a meaningful difference for our customers, every day. As a Customer Representative, you will make a real impact from day one. You’ll be a key part of the branch team, supporting customers in person, over the phone and online; helping with everyday transactions, answering queries and guiding customers toward banking services and digital tools.
Where you’ll be working:
- Branch location: Nantwich, Cheshire
- Position: Permanent, full‑time, 35 hours per week, Monday to Saturday.
- Commute: must be within a 45‑minute journey of the branch.
- Start date will be confirmed after an offer.
- Salary: From 1 July 2026, the minimum salary for this role will be £26,500.
What you’ll be doing:
- Welcome customers into the branch and take the time to understand their needs and offer trusted, friendly help with their banking.
- Handle a range of transactions and queries accurately, keeping customer needs, security and fairness front of mind.
- Guide customers through banking products and services that are right for them, helping them to manage their money with confidence.
- Work closely with colleagues within a busy branch environment, supporting one another to deliver excellent customer service even at peak times.
- Take responsibility for doing things the right way: following processes, spotting potential issues, and escalating concerns where needed to protect customers and Nationwide.
- Play a vital role in keeping face‑to‑face banking meaningful and accessible on the high street, helping customers to feel supported, respected and confident in their banking.

How to prepare for a job interview at Description This
✨Show Off Your People Skills
In customer support, it's all about communicating effectively. Prepare to share instances from your past experiences where you handled difficult customers or resolved conflicts. We want to hear how you empathised and found the best solutions, so think of specific examples to back up your stories!
✨Know the Tools of the Trade
Familiarise yourself with common customer support tools like Zendesk or Freshdesk, and make sure to review how you’ve used any similar systems in the past. During the interview, being able to discuss your hands-on experience with software or ticketing systems can really set you apart from the competition, so don’t skip this prep!
✨Show Genuine Enthusiasm
As this is a full-time role, employers want someone who isn’t just looking for any job, but wants to grow within customer support. Make sure to express your enthusiasm for helping customers and your desire to develop your skills. Show them why you're passionate about this field!
✨Practice Common Scenarios
Be prepared for role-playing scenarios where you might have to reassess a solution with a frustrated customer or explain a complex process in simple terms. Practising these common scenarios can help us feel more confident and demonstrate our practical skills effectively during the interview.
